Weleda Baby Bath & Skin Care Products Protect, Soothe and Heal with Calendula


When I first started researching nontoxic bath and skincare products for babies back in 2007, Weleda was one of the first brands to cross my radar, as an eco-friendly and pure option. I was writing a story about The Little Seed boutique on Larchmont in Los Angeles, and they had a changing room/nursing area for babies and moms that was stocked with Weleda products. I've always wanted to try Weleda, but never have until recently. I'm sorry I waited so long because their products are fantastic.

I've written before about the importance of bathing your little ones in a toxin free tub- from the bath products you use to the toys, to the actual tub itself. Weleda's mother and baby care collection fits the bill perfectly and goes above and beyond in measures of product safety, performance and integrity.
At the crux of their collection for baby's sensitive skin is healing and soothing organic Biodynamic®calendula -- and everything in the line is plant-based, tear free and completely free of synthetic ingredients. The fresh fragrances detected in the products are derived from essential oils, and when I bathed Miss O with the Weleda Calendula Shampoo and Body Wash, she was delighted by the scent. It's nourishing, moisturizing and lathers well, so a little goes a long way.

I would highly recommend the Weleda Baby Starter Kit as a lovely baby shower gift and/or to have packed in your bag of tricks for baby's first bath. If you're having a hospital birth, take this starter kit with you and ask the nurses to bathe baby using the non-toxic and organic shampoo and baby wash, keeping in mind that babies -- and big kids, and adults too!-- absorb everything into their skin and then into their bloodstream. Also in the kit: diaper care, baby cream, lotion and face cream. Buying this kit is a great, economical way to get an introduction to the collection too.

Weleda recently celebrated their 90th anniversary, and they work hard to protect our planet and support humanity via their business practices and charitable contributions. Weleda is truly a pioneer of the green movement, employing sustainable farming methods and upholding Fair Trade standards long before there was a mainstream effort in place in these realms.

Live Clean Baby Skin Care Products Bring Green to the Mainstream


The most prevalent reasons people offer for not living an eco-friendly lifestyle is that green products are too expensive and too hard to find. So I was thrilled to discover a collection of baby bath and skin care products, Live Clean Baby, that are not only sustainably crafted, but also affordable ($7.99 each) and readily available at Walgreens drugstores -- making it much easier for parents to choose healthy, nontoxic personal care products for their babies. (And ditch Johnson & Johnson once and for all!)

The Live Clean Baby collection has got green babies covered from head to toe. Products in the line include: Moisturizing Baby Bath, Shampoo and Wash, Moisturizing Baby Lotion, Diaper Ointment, Moisturizing Bar Soap and Non-Petroleum Jelly.

I love the Non-Petroleum Jelly the most because it goes on smooth and it's not at all greasy. Mr. A took a nasty spill and I used it on the scab on his face, to keep it from feeling tight, and it has done a remarkable job aiding in the healing process as well. It is simply comprised of three ingredients: castor seed oil, cera alba and tocopherol. This is an ingenious alternative to the (gasp!) petroleum jelly parents have been using for decades - because it is effective and safe. The diaper ointment is also great, and combines zinc oxide with several soothing plant based ingredients including chamomile and lavender.

I also really like the fragrance free bar soap (three full size bars come in each package) and I have been using it myself in the shower. And the baby shampoo and wash suds up nicely without the use of SLS. Also, a teeny, tiny bit of the shampoo and wash goes such a long way -- so you can really get your money's worth.

I really enjoy these products and I think they're a great choice for families who want to detoxify their baby's bath time regimen. The only thing I wish I could change about them is the added ingredients to give them their fragrance.  I love the scent of these products, but I'd prefer if they all came in a fragrance free version, (the bar soap and non-petroleum jelly are available fragrance free), because I think the fragrance is nice, but not necessary, and that ditching the fragrance would raise the integrity of the products' ingredients list.

Here's the 411 on Live Clean Baby products eco attributes: all products are vegan, never tested on animals, FREE of sodium lauryl sulfate, DEA, parabens, petroleum, phosphates and phthalates. Formulations are made with a minimum of 98% replenishable, renewable and sustainable natural and plant ingredients, and packaging is recyclable.

Piggy Paint: Non-Toxic, Natural Nail Polish for Girls


The official start of summer is less than two weeks away... but I'm sure many little piggies have already been running around in sandals and flip-flops. After buying this season's flip-flops, Miss O asked me to paint her nails. Thank goodness all-natural polishes such as Piggy Paint are on the market to keep the endeavor free of harmful toxins.

Available in an array of vibrant hues as shown above, we were fans of two of the more subtle shades of Piggy Paint: Sweetpea and Glass Slippers, which are a pale pink and a clear sparkly polish respectively. Piggy Paints are free of the toxins found in most conventional polishes, including, formaldehyde, toluene, phthalates, Bisphenol A, ethyl acetate and acetone. The natural ingredients in Piggy Paint are listed here.

The folks at Piggy Paint shared the following information and beauty regimen to achieve the best results for using their polishes:

Piggy Paint typically wears a couple days shy of solvent-based polishes when applied as directed.  Wear depends of on the type of nails, the activities the nails are involved in (polish obviously doesn't wear as well on children because they are so hard on their nails), and how the polish is applied.

For maximum chip resistance, we recommend the following application instructions: Wash hands with soap and water. Apply 2 -3 thin coats of Piggy Paint, Air dry 60 seconds. Blow dry polished nails for 1 minute with hair dryer set on warm heat/low blower setting. Since our polish is water-based, it takes longer to cure and the blow dryer speeds up this process. For safety purposes, please follow manufacturer’s instructions on blow dryer and always monitor your child. 

(Tip: Sing 2 rounds of ABC's while blow drying for added fun!) Use Piggy Paint Primecoat for added scratch resistance and Piggy Paint Topcoat for added chip resistance. A little more effort is required to apply all three products, though the result is well worth the extra time. Since our polish does not contain the harsh chemicals found in solvent-based polishes, do not expect it to wear exactly the same (but pretty close).  Our customers tell us it is well worth the trade-off for a non-toxic, eco-friendly, odorless alternative!

Miss O loved her Piggy Paint. We applied it during Mr. A's nap time so we couldn't use the blow dryer, and admittedly the polish came off in the bathtub the same evening. So, I would definitely take the extra time to follow all of the instructions so your child's manicure and pedicure will last longer!

NEW! Method Mickey & Minnie Mouse Soap, Whistle While You Wash



Hand-washing is such an event around our house, and I've been looking for a way to make the process more fun for Miss O -- but the fun hand soaps geared toward kids are usually filled with toxic ingredients I'm not willing to let her lather up with. So when I learned Method is debuting these adorable Mickey & Minnie Mouse hand soaps April 1st at Target, I knew they would help her get "squeaky" clean while making her excited to have her very own special soap. The delicious scents are Lemonade Mickey and Strawberry Fizz Minnie, and it's amazing how the simple act of shaping a soap dispenser like the iconic mouse ears will really rev a kid up to dash to the sink after going potty.

Additionally, the soap is biodegradable and non-toxic,and it doesn't contain parabens, phthalates, triclosan, EDTA or animal-by products. And the cute packaging is recyclable and made with 25% recycled plastic -- and never tested on mice (ha ha) or other animals.

We use Method products throughout our home, and love how they work well without using toxins which compromise our health or the planet's well-being. I must note, this Method hand soap does use the ingredient sodium lauryl sulfate, which is classified as a toxic ingredient by the Skin Deep website. So I asked the folks at Method to explain their use of SLS and they gave me this informative reply I think we may all benefit from:

Method:

"Yes, we do in fact use this particular ingredient, which is derived from coconut oil and used for its lathering and efficacy properties, in a number of our products at minute levels. There has been some controversy over SLS being carcinogenic. SLS is a safe ingredient and has not been classified as a known, probable or even suspected carcinogen by either the International Agency for Research on Cancer (www.iarc.fr) or the American Cancer Society (www.cancer.org). The ACS has actually gone so far as to issue a statement to this effect. While the carcinogen concern is completely unfounded, SLS can in fact be a moderate skin and eye irritant when used in high concentrations and unbuffered. Method only uses SLS in our formulations at sufficiently low concentrations so that any irritation concern is irrelevant. When deciding to use Sodium Lauryl Sulfate in some of our formulations, Method did a complete assessment of the environmental and health aspects of this ingredient, including tests for toxicity and biodegradability. This was done in cooperation with the EPEA, an independent environmental research institute led by Dr. Michael Braungart, author of the landmark text Cradle to Cradle. Their findings showed SLS to be altogether safe in its intended usage, non-toxic, non-carcinogenic and environmentally preferable."

Eco-friendly Biodegradable Training Potty


Ah, potty training. Easily one of the most arduous undertakings of parenting. While our little one is now a pro at going on the regular potty (thank heavens!), during her training days, we had purchased her the Baby Bjorn potty chair, which worked great, suited her well, and was convenient, comfortable and easy to clean. But alas, now we're left with a hunk of bright pink plastic, which we'll no doubt find a way to make more boy-friendly when it's our boy's turn to learn how to use the potty, but nonetheless, what's to become of it once he's mastered the art?

When I happened across the Becopotty, I had to share it with you, because I wish I had known about it when we were in the market for a toilet training potty. The Becopotty is made from waste plant material (bamboo waste and rice husks, which are leftover materials from farming, and by adding a biodegradable resin and pressing the powder in a hot mould a Becopotty is born. The potty lasts for years in your home, but will start biodegrading immediately upon being placed in your garden. How brilliant is that?

The only somewhat inconvenient component I can see with relation to this potty is that it doesn't have a removable, easy to clean insert like the Baby Bjorn potty does, so it will be harder to clean out after every use. But, that's a small price to pay for having a potty that biodegrades back into the earth, as opposed to taking up space in a landfill indefinitely as plastic.
